PROS
This slow cooker pulled chicken verde recipe is incredibly easy to make and requires minimal effort.
The combination of green enchilada and tomatillo sauces give this dish a tangy and spicy flavor that is sure to please your taste buds.
It can be served as a taco filling, on top of rice, or as a sandwich for a variety of meal options.
CONS
Depending on the brand of sauces used, this dish can be high in sodium and may not be suitable for individuals on a low-sodium diet.
It is also important to ensure that the chicken is fully cooked to avoid any risk of food poisoning.
